Committee advances 'PA Promise' last-dollar scholarship after amendment expanding eligibility

House Education Committee · February 5, 2026

The House Education Committee adopted an amendment expanding House Bill 2084 (the Pennsylvania Promise Program) to include students at independent colleges and then voted to move the bill to the House floor; supporters called it a last-dollar scholarship to improve college affordability, opponents raised cost concerns.

House Education Committee members voted to advance House Bill 2084, the "PA Promise," after adopting an amendment to expand eligibility to students attending independent institutions of higher education.
